Tag Archives: tools

Steps for SharePoint and PHP Integration

Steps for SharePoint and PHP Integration

With the help of document libraries and custom lists, it is possible to read list data directly from SharePoint into the existing PHP application. In this way, a number of possibilities can be explored. Certain PHP tools are available through which it is possible to leverage the potential of the .NET Connector within the world of PHP. It ensures convenient access to SharePoint data such as documents and items. If developers are capable of working with recognized ADO.NET frameworks as well as SQL, it enhances the production quality, thus making the development process faster.

Connection of PHP applications

Developers now can avail the facility of connecting their respective PHP applications to SharePoint with the help of SQL, with the same convenience as is applicable in case of an ordinary database. Existing PHP tools are able to handle predefined lists such as the ‘Task list’ or the ‘Calendar’. Custom document libraries as well as lists can also be handled.

Seamless Integration with SharePoint

PHP tools available in the market assist in saving a lot of time when it comes to integrating with the document management system. With the help of these tools, you will be able to make use of the following aspects: –

Convenient installation is possible by simply including the library files, then setting up the connection settings to the SharePoint installation service. –

Through the use of the tools, it is possible to completely handle custom list items, develop any list that is required and that too, instantly. Moreover, predefined list items can also be managed. Again, you can also manage document libraries, folders as well as documents. You can even go for storage of data in database or dynamically read through the SharePoint integration service. –

Developers can effectively leverage these tools to work faster, developing better as well as increasingly flexible solutions. Every input-output from SharePoint gets transformed into the recognized database computer language Structured Query Language. Therefore it is easy to normalize the development process. As a result of this, developers with no prior expertise in SharePoint integration or development are able to conveniently work with document libraries along with list data.

Benefits of SharePoint and PHP Integration

Through the integration of SharePoint with PHP, there are a number of benefits that are achieved: –

The threshold of requisite knowledge is considerably brought down while working with data and integration pertaining to the document management system.

The productivity of developers can be enhanced –

The maintenance costs can be lessened. –

The need for specific training for developers can be brought down to a great extent. –

The integration ensures easier support to data connectivity.

Features and Steps

Through the SharePoint integration service provided by a number of companies, the document management system can be queried like a regular database, irrespective of whether you are making the selection from amongst a default list, an edited version of a default list, a document library or a custom list. The data will be retrieved and made available to meet the specific requirements. You can go for the following: –

Choose explicit columns (SELECT Title, Id, FROM customList) –

Choose everything (SELECT * FROM customList, include the .all in the list name to obtain each element that is available from the list) –

Make the choice by view (SELECT * FROM viewName, customList.)

There are PHP tools offering support for creation, reading, updations and deletion with the help of SQL syntax in addition to stored procedures. Comprehensive handling of list items is made convenient along with management of document libraries as well as the respective items (documents and folders).

Whether it is SharePoint 2010 development, or any other version, by leveraging a diverse collection of PHP classes, developers are capable of easily integrating SharePoint and PHP.

We provide sharepoint development services. If you would like to know what makes us expert sharepoint programmers, please contact us at Mindfire Solutions.

http://www.sooperarticles.com/technology-articles/software-articles/steps-sharepoint-php-integration-1250077.html

10 Essential Features of Web Hosting

10 Essential Features of Web Hosting

Anyone that wants to be seen on the Internet needs to have a website. There are literally thousands of web hosts to choose from so finding the right web hosting packages can be a confusing process, especially if you are new to web hosting. This series of articles will assist you in sorting out all the information available and give you the confidence to make the best decision about choosing reliable web hosting. You will find that web hosting packages can vary in pricing as well as the features they offer such as the amount of disk space and bandwidth available, data transfers, number of domains and email boxes, privacy and security settings, website design and marketing tools, technical support and guaranteed uptime. Knowing what your requirements are is essential to making a smart choice.

Let’s look at the features that are essential to reliable web hosting:
1.DISK SPACE / STORAGE – A web hosting account has an allotment of disk/storage space that you rent on a server. The amount of storage will include all of the content of your web pages, any graphic or audiovisual content you may use on those pages, any files that are available for visitors to download and any space that you may use for emails. You will also need to allow space for the various log files that are generated by the server that keeps track of visitors to your site and what pages they click on. You may want to choose a package with additional disk space so as you add more content such as pictures, music, videos or downloadable files that require more disk space, there are no additional costs. Databases are usually calculated separately from your disk/storage space allocated, so check with your web host to see what their policy covers.

2.DATA TRANSFER / BANDWIDTH – These two functions are an important factor when choosing reliable web hosting. They are similar but different aspects of the same process that work hand in hand.

Data transfer is how much data is being transferred on a monthly basis. Your website may not be accessible the less data transfer that is allocated on a monthly basis. Going over your allocated limit can result in a fee or even a temporary shutdown of your website. Be sure to choose a plan with more data transfer than your current needs to allow for additional traffic and content.

Bandwidth is how much data can be transferred at one time. The less bandwidth you are allocated, the slower your website takes to load regardless of the speed of the visitor’s connection. Higher bandwidth is expensive because it ties up the server’s resources and can affect the performance of other customer sites on the server. An important factor to consider when choosing a web host is the fact that they can terminate your Domain name and close the account without refund.

3.DOMAIN NAME – The Domain name is your unique name and address on the Worldwide Web. Domain registration is the process that an individual or a company secures a website domain, such as www.yoursite.com. Once you have completed domain registration, the domain name becomes yours for a specified period of time, usually one year. You must renew you domain name before your registration expires, or the domain reverts back to being available to the general public. Be sure that you own your domain name. Some web host’s maintain control of the domains they register so it’s important that you retain the option to transfer the domain to another registrar. You should read the “Terms and Conditions” regarding maintaining your privacy and any additional fees to transfer to your domain to another registrar.

4.DEDICATED VS. SHARED IP ADDRESS – An Internet Protocol address, or better known as an IP address, is the numerical address of the website that tells other computers where to find the server host and your domain on the Internet. There are advantages to having a dedicated IP address vs. a shared IP address which is explained in the next section.

Dedicated IP Address means that your site is the only one on the Internet using that IP address number. The advantages of having a dedicated IP address are that you can get your site better SEO (search engine optimization) ratings which make your website more visible and easier to find; there are better security and privacy options. A Private SSL Certificate was created to confirm the identity of a website or server and ensure secure transactions between web servers and browsers. In order to keep clients information secure, a Private SSL Certificate is required for ECommerce websites that accept online credit card payments.

Shared IP Address means there could be hundreds of websites sharing one server that share a single IP address. Shared IP addresses make it easier for hosting companies to manage and maintain their servers and offer this feature at a lower cost. The downside to this feature is if other websites sharing your IP address are banned or blacklisted due to spamming or scamming, their actions directly affect your website. Your website could disappear from the search engines and your email could be blocked by Internet Service Providers (ISP). A Shared SSL Certificate gives you the benefits of a SSL Certificate at a lower cost and still provides a secure URL (Uniform Resource Locator). Many Ecommerce websites provide Shared SSL to their business clients.

5.EMAIL FEATURES – Email hosting offers a variety of features for both individuals and businesses. Some of the features offered are customized email addresses, import/export your address book, unlimited storage, webmail accessible from your mobile phone or PDA, calendar alerts, mail forwarding, auto responders, email filters that protect you from viruses and spam, phone and email tech support.

6.GUARANTEED UPTIME – This is one of the most important features of a reliable web hosting provider. Guaranteed uptime means your website is guaranteed to be up at least 99.9% of the time and available to visitors. When your website is unavailable, traffic and potential clients will be drawn to your competitor’s sites and ultimately lost sales. This guarantee should include network uptime, server uptime, web server and service uptime as well as 24/7 support.

7.CONTROL PANEL FEATURES – The most important job that a website owner has is creating and management of the website(s) and its content. The C-Panel features the tools for uploading and managing web pages, managing domains, subdomains, FTP accounts, creating parked domains, add-on domains, protecting your directories, redirecting visitors to another location, website statistics, back up data, virus protection and spam filters, the tools to keep your privacy and security.

8.PRIVACY & SECURITY – The security of your communications such as unauthorized or sensitive data are a huge concern. Some of the security tools that a web host may include are SSL secure servers, SSL certificates, high quality software that can prevent other websites from directly accessing your databases and files, anti-virus protection, reliable authentication, secure payment processing, firewall protection, use of strong passwords, email encryption and strict privacy policies.

9.TECH SUPPORT – A reliable web hosting provider should have technical support available 24/7. Get a quick reply to your support ticket should any issues arise and getting instant support via a live chat service or telephone support.

10.WEBSITE BUILDING TOOLS – Even if you have no prior knowledge or experience, Website building tools are often offered as part of a web hosting package. The more advanced website building tools teach you how to add a photo album, guestbook, ads, newsletters, blogs, FAQ module, visitor tracker, banner rotator, auto installer software for blogs, forums, galleries and much more.

For more information about web hosting services, plan options as well as a Free Membership for access to a huge selection of free products, software and marketing tools worth thousands of dollars. So make your web presence stand out, no matter what your experience level. Don’t miss out on the opportunity of a lifetime, visit http://www.internetmarketersclubhouse.com/.

http://imcdirector.articlealley.com/10-essential-features-of-web-hosting-2422177.html

VB Net POS Accounting

VB Net POS Accounting

VB dot Net framework provides the best base ground for POS and Accounting software, because both systems need great support to access and process data frequently, and Visual Basic with .Net framework seems to work very well. Since VS2005, Rapid Application Development tools enable developer to create business software in the fastest time ever!

Only RAD development will guarantee the database related project to success in the shortest time and deliver the highest quality. VS2005 comes with SQL server 2005 express edition, which is free for desktop application and small business software. SQL Server 2005 plays an important row to ensure scalability of storage and software.

There are many source codes based POS and Accounting software, but only very few employed Rapid Application Development methodology and design, this brings lots of work for developer if the source code not already supporting RAD programming.

When choosing the suitable source code, one should consider to adapt to the latest tools and technology, legacy coding will only slow your overall development time! Why pay for legacy technology when you can enjoy the best out of the newest tools and coding! Cynics POS and Accounting is built on the pure dot net platform, SQL stored procedure and RAD tools such as visual inheritance and Dataset Designer.

Cynics POS even enjoy the offline benefit of dot net remoting! Your POS system will store all information locally and synchronize back to the server when connection are available. Up until now only very few software in the market can provide such a great feature, and this feature is expected to gain popularity by the introduction of Microsoft Sync Framework for ADO.Net.

Let’s summarize some of the great features that a good source code based POS and Accounting system should have:

Feature #1 – Offline Capability.
Able to work offline and not dependent on network connection to store data.

Feature #2 – Stored Procedure Processing.
Using powerful database stored procedure to speed up the processing time.

Feature #3 – RAD Design and Coding.
Use the latest Design and Coding method, code the software using RAD tools and speed up the maintenance process!

These are the 3 most important features, beware to check for these criteria before proceed… Invest your money carefully.

(C) Copyright 2008 CYNICS SOFTWARE – Feel free to reprint this article in its entirety as long as all links and author resources box in place.

Find out more information about fully RAD coding and Offline Capable source code based Software: VB Net Framework POS Accounting System.

http://kkchoon.articlealley.com/vb-net–pos-accounting-549697.html